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Peoples Bancorp Inc. reported that it released its financial results for the fourth quarter of 2025 and is hosting a conference call and webcast for analysts and investors to discuss the results.

The Board of Directors declared a quarterly dividend of $0.41 per common share, reflecting ongoing cash returns to shareholders. The company also announced a planned leadership transition in commercial banking, as long-time Executive Vice President and Chief Commercial Banking Officer Douglas V. Wyatt intends to retire effective April 3, 2026.

To maintain continuity, the Boards of Peoples and Peoples Bank elected Ron J. Majka as Executive Vice President, Chief Commercial Banking Officer of both entities, with his appointment effective April 4, 2026, the day after Mr. Wyatt’s retirement.

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

On January 15, 2026, Peoples Bancorp Inc. (“Peoples”) received notice that Douglas V. Wyatt intends to retire from his position as Executive Vice President, Chief Commercial Banking Officer, of Peoples effective April 3, 2026. Mr. Wyatt will also be retiring from his position as Executive Vice President, Chief Commercial Banking Officer, of Peoples’ banking subsidiary, Peoples Bank.

Item 8.01     Other Events

Declaration of Dividend:

On January 20, 2026, Peoples issued a news release announcing that the Board of Directors declared a quarterly dividend of $0.41 per common share on January 19, 2026. A copy of the news release is included as Exhibit 99.3 to this Current Report on Form 8-K.

Officer Election:

On January 16, 2026, Peoples Bancorp Inc. (“Peoples”) issued a news release announcing that the Boards of Directors of Peoples and its banking subsidiary, Peoples Bank, elected Ron J. Majka to the position of Executive Vice President, Chief Commercial Banking Officer, of Peoples and Peoples Bank. Mr. Majka will assume these offices effective April 4, 2026. A copy of the news release issued by Peoples is filed with this Current Report on Form 8-K as Exhibit 99.4 and incorporated herein by reference.

Mr. Majka will succeed Douglas V. Wyatt, who has served as Executive Vice President, Chief Commercial Banking Officer, of Peoples and Peoples Bank since 2017. On January 15, 2026, Peoples received notice that Mr. Wyatt intends to retire effective April 3, 2026.
